We are seeking a highly motivated and skilled Civil Engineer to join our dynamic and fast-paced team. This position provides an exciting opportunity to work on a wide range of complex and high-profile projects, from land development to water and sewer infrastructure. The successful candidate will be responsible for the design and implementation of civil engineering projects, ensuring that all work is carried out to the highest standard and in accordance with local zoning laws and regulations.
Responsibilities:
As a Civil Engineer, you will be responsible for:
1. Developing detailed designs for civil engineering projects, including stormwater management systems, drainage, grading, and utilities.
2. Using advanced software tools such as Civil 3D and Autoturn to create accurate and efficient designs.
3. Ensuring all designs comply with local zoning laws and regulations, and obtaining necessary permits.
4. Overseeing the development of land, including the design and implementation of erosion and sediment controls.
5. Preparing and submitting SWPPP and SEQRA reports.
6. Managing the design and implementation of water and sewer infrastructure projects.
7. Coordinating with other team members and stakeholders to ensure projects are completed on time and within budget.
8. Conducting site visits to monitor progress and ensure compliance with design specifications and safety standards.
9. Providing technical support and guidance to junior team members.
Qualifications:
The ideal candidate will have:
1. A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ering or a related field. A Master's degree or Professional Engineer (PE) certification is preferred.
2. A minimum of 3 years of experience in civil engineering, with a focus on civil design, stormwater management, drainage, grading, and land development.
3. Proficiency in Civil 3D, Autoturn, and other relevant software tools.
4. A strong understanding of local zoning laws and regulations, and experience in obtaining permits.
5. Experience in preparing and submitting SWPPP and SEQRA reports.
6. A proven track record in managing water and sewer infrastructure projects.
7.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to work effectively under pressure.
8. Strong communication and teamwork skills, with the ability to lead and mentor junior team members.
9. A valid driver's license and the ability to travel to project sites as needed.
